Toast service angular. step 1: add css copy toast css to your project.
Toast service angular Steps to install and use toast/toaster to show messages or notifications in angular projects: Step 1 – Create New Angular App. The Angular application that we are going to create will use the Smart Angular ToastComponent and three Smart Angular ButtonComponents which will show/hide the Toast items. Create a new component with Angular CLI and add some HTML code to the template. How does it work? The Toastr library is an injectable service that you can add to your components and then call it to show toast messages in your Angular application Mar 6, 2022 · In this post, we want to have a look on how to create a service for sending Bootstrap 5 toast notifications using Angular 14. In the typescript of the toast component we just make a… Jul 23, 2023 · How to Install and Use Toaster Notification in Angular 16. ts service file using @Injectable and provide a service name as ‘ ToastService ’. Files. success on the success message from API this. The following steps explain how to use the Toast component as a separate Angular service: Step #1: Create a separate toast. I have service called notification service which handles toast messages from ngx-toastr library. Service The main part of the toast service is a BehaviorSubject. 我们有一个简单的带空函数体的 show 方法的服务。 唯一值得注意的是,我们使用了自 Angular 6 以来可用的 Injectable 装饰器的 providedIn 新属性,将 root 指定为值。 Jul 3, 2017 · Angular Toast Message Notifications From Scratch ⚠️ This lesson has been archived! Check out the Full Angular Course for the latest best practices. Nov 21, 2018 · In this post, we will explore how to leverage this to create a toast service that can be used to show toast messages throughout your application. To add alerts to your Angular application copy the /src/app/_alert folder from the example project into your project, the folder contains the following alert module and associated files: Angular Toast Service. 23. Nov 23, 2022 · To do this first install the Angular CLI globally on your system with the command npm install -g @angular/cli. The following guide shows how to use the ToastComponent as an Angular Service. To achieve this, follow these steps: 1. Jan 6, 2022 · I am working with an app based on Angular 12. Aug 2, 2024 · In Angular, we have a styling component called ngx-toastr, widely used for displaying non-blocking notifications to the user. In Angular, a service is a class that is responsible for providing specific functionality and data to different parts of an application. Setup. 3K views 834 forks. Smart. ts import { NgModule } from '@angular/core'; import { BrowserModule } from '@angular/platform-browser'; Auto hide the toast. Toast component provides the following methods to define the Angular service: createToast è creates and returns the toast component. I am using toastr. 首先,这个 toast 不是祝酒词的意思,而是代表了其他的意思(注:toast service,类似安卓中提供的消息提示推送 Feb 21, 2024 · We need to use provideToastr and provideAnimations to add the services of the library to the environment providers (providers array of bootstrapApplication object as shown below), as mentioned in the documentation. First of all, open your command prompt or cmd to install & setup angular new project in system by executing the following command on command prompt or cmd: The Best Angular Toast in Town Smoking hot Angular notifications. First, we need to add CDK as a dependency to our project: or if you prefer npm: Now we can use what we need from the CDK. module. boolean: true: color: Sets the color context of the component to one of CoreUI’s themed colors. Model Our model contains information about the title, message, position, notification type. Feb 12, 2015 ·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and Feb 24, 2024 · How to Use toast/toaster Notification in Angular 17. success(this. Services act as Nov 5, 2022 · Below are the steps to include the PrimeNG Toast in Angular Projects // app. Colors: undefined: delay: Delay hiding the toast (ms). If you are using sass you can import the css. Starter project for Angular apps that exports to the Angular CLI. // regular style toast @import ' ~ngx-toastr/toastr '; // bootstrap style toast // or import a bootstrap 4 alert styled design (SASS ONLY) // should be after your bootstrap imports, it uses bs4 variables, mixins, functions May 22, 2023 · Part 3: Angular Toast Service Source Code. You can create toast dynamically from any component using a built-in service. number: 5000: fade: Apply fade transition to the toast. How to add Alerts to your Angular 14 App. If adding buttons to a toast, always provide alternative ways of completing the actions associated with each button. In this lesson, we are going to build toast notifications from scratch with Angular 4. Build your web apps using Smart UI. Angular Generator Don't want to use @angular/animations?See Setup Without Animations. Toast - Toast as an Angular Service Overview. Apr 8, 2023 · Learn how to create a custom service in Angular that implements a custom toastr message. New Folder. Angular Material is a great material UI design components library for Mar 26, 2022 · In this article, we will make our own toast notification using Angular. Dec 10, 2020 · I want to increase display time for ngx-toastr. step 1: add css copy toast css to your project. This is how that service looks like: export class Nov 21, 2018 · Prepare yourself, this will be a long read, starting from scratch up to a full-blown, almost, production-ready toast service. toastr. This component helps enhance the user experience by providing feedback for various actions like success, error, info, and warning messages. This ensures that even if the toast dismisses before a user can read it, they can still complete the actions shown in the toast. successMessage); Mar 26, 2022 · The main part of the toast service is a BehaviorSubject. ;# f ö‡¨#uáÏŸ ¿{M>Ÿ$ª×óæî 5 € 0+r 5:˜ ‰ vÛ ŠÒD? ¬ ’‹Â ¢ï[½ª÷\NpÊ 0ð€ÅbSš’N% W µ¢Å$Ÿ–Fd¾ÇÿRWönª} îQ~‚ =ƒC¤“÷ÏþÓi5Z9 - =w©ú MòÿïUåY °. Our Angular Toaster consists of the following three parts: First, we need to create the toast service that we can later call from our application to send different types of toasts. boolean: true: visible: Toggle the visibility of component. Jan 30, 2021 · The ngx-toastr library makes it easy to add Toastr notifications to your Angular application. Using this subscription we will be notified when we need to show Toast notification. [翻译]-使用 Angular CDK 技术来创建一个消息推送服务(toast service) 原文:Creating a toast service with Angular CDK 作者:Adrian Fâciu 译者:秋天; 校对者:尊重. ƒ/;QTÕ~ €FÊÂùûý¯šU¹’è/רû®H ©©âŽºýø7Ò «…ù¨Âˆ ¸ Êh}”Üù(Ú(\߯ÔòtŦ#0À …Ú eg^çµJ=âÚMI äôzø÷¶,ócSš,E ̯r Toast is an overlay component for displaying messages in Angular applications using PrimeNG. Follow our step-by-step guide and create a custom toastr message service that meets your specific project requirements May 15, 2022 · Create a toast component with a conditional styling mechanism; Define states with stored strings to feed it; Use cool animations from Angular's core packages; Trigger the toast from anywhere in the app (by any service or from any parent component that calls it) Execution Workflow Oct 7, 2023 · In this guide, will learn how to quickly install and configure the Ngx-Toastr package and see examples of how to display various types of Toastr messages like success, info, warnings, and errors. src. Avoid showing a toast with buttons from inside another overlay such as a modal. . We will also dive deep into advanced topics like customizing the appearance and behaviour of Toastr, and using it in services and components. New File. Steps to integrate and use toaster notifications in angular project using ngx-toastr; are as follows: Step 1 – Create New Angular App; Step 2 – Install ngx-toastr package; Step 3 – Import and configure the ToastrModule; Step 4 – Implement the toaster service . boolean: false Customizable Angular UI Library based on Eva Design System with 40+ UI components, 4 visual themes, Auth and Security modules Dec 31, 2019 · If you won't show anything other than errorMessage (ie something specific to component), the interceptor or a custom HTTP service could be a better place for the sake of not repeating the same code. ojv olr xkwdb uhxi sapi lka etll hqya ojmqy leud